Skip to content
This repository has been archived by the owner on Nov 17, 2023. It is now read-only.

Update MKL-DNN submodule to v0.19 #14783

Merged
merged 10 commits into from
May 16, 2019
Merged
2 changes: 1 addition & 1 deletion 3rdparty/mkldnn
2 changes: 1 addition & 1 deletion ci/docker/install/ubuntu_mklml.sh
Original file line number Diff line number Diff line change
Expand Up @@ -21,5 +21,5 @@
# the whole docker cache for the image

set -ex
wget -q --no-check-certificate -O /tmp/mklml.tgz https://github.com/intel/mkl-dnn/releases/download/v0.18/mklml_lnx_2019.0.3.20190220.tgz
wget -q --no-check-certificate -O /tmp/mklml.tgz https://github.com/intel/mkl-dnn/releases/download/v0.19/mklml_lnx_2019.0.5.20190502.tgz
tar -zxf /tmp/mklml.tgz && cp -rf mklml_*/* /usr/local/ && rm -rf mklml_*
10 changes: 5 additions & 5 deletions cmake/DownloadMKLML.cmake
Original file line number Diff line number Diff line change
Expand Up @@ -19,12 +19,12 @@

message(STATUS "Downloading MKLML...")

set(MKLDNN_RELEASE v0.18)
set(MKLML_RELEASE_FILE_SUFFIX 2019.0.3.20190220)
set(MKLDNN_RELEASE v0.19)
set(MKLML_RELEASE_FILE_SUFFIX 2019.0.5.20190502)

set(MKLML_LNX_MD5 76354b74325cd293aba593d7cbe36b3f)
set(MKLML_WIN_MD5 02286cb980f12af610c05e99dbd78755)
set(MKLML_MAC_MD5 3b28da686a25a4cf995ca4fc5e30e514)
set(MKLML_LNX_MD5 dfcea335652dbf3518e1d02cab2cea97)
set(MKLML_WIN_MD5 ff8c5237570f03eea37377ccfc95a08a)
set(MKLML_MAC_MD5 0a3d83ec1fed9ea318e8573bb5e14c24)

if(MSVC)
set(MKL_NAME "mklml_win_${MKLML_RELEASE_FILE_SUFFIX}")
Expand Down
2 changes: 1 addition & 1 deletion tests/cpp/operator/mkldnn_test.cc
Original file line number Diff line number Diff line change
Expand Up @@ -100,7 +100,7 @@ static void VerifyDefMem(const mkldnn::memory &mem) {

TEST(MKLDNN_UTIL_FUNC, MemFormat) {
// Check whether the number of format is correct.
CHECK_EQ(mkldnn_format_last, 114);
CHECK_EQ(mkldnn_format_last, 145);
CHECK_EQ(mkldnn_nchw, 7);
CHECK_EQ(mkldnn_oihw, 16);
}
Expand Down